[0020] Hereinafter, the present invention will be described in detail with reference to the accompanying drawings and the embodiments.
[0021] Reference Figure 1-Figure 4 As shown, a fluid damper that uses elastic body vibration and energy consumption includes a connecting flange 1, a guide rod 2, a sealing body 4, a main cylinder 5, a piston 6 and an auxiliary cylinder 8. The fluid damper passes through two The connecting flange 1 at one end is connected to the main structure, the connecting flange 1 at one end is connected to the guide rod 2, and the connecting flange 1 at the other end is connected to the attached cylinder 8 through a first nut 31 The piston 6 is installed in the middle position of the master cylinder 5 through the guide rod 2, and the master cylinder 5 and the auxiliary cylinder 8 are connected by a second nut 32. The sealing body 4 and the first nut 31 and the second nut 32 are closed, and the inside is filled with the damping fluid 9.
